In spite of the recession, fiber-optic cabling sales have been on the rise for the past five years. This is due in part to modern-day bandwidth intensive applications, growth of fiber to the premise (FTTP) applications, and the notion of some industry pundits who believe that copper cabling is reaching its limits. In addition, the perception that fiber-optic cabling is too difficult to install or too expensive, has virtually disappeared. Many people–from homeowners to network managers and system engineers–are discovering that fiber-optic cabling and technology are feasible.

The construction slowdown has resulted in many electricians vacating the standard power wiring space and entering the low-voltage/datacom wiring market. In addition, manufacturers have seen a marked rise in the technical education level of the datacom installer and network technician as the industry segment has matured. White claims it is the VoIP, PoE, and security applications that have continued driving the requirement for new tools
